Kentucky’s Javess Blue makes one-handed TD catch (Video)
The Kentucky Wildcats are not going to win the SEC this season, but they could win for having the best catch of the day in Week 7.
Kentucky Wildcats quarterback Patrick Towles has found a new go-to target after Javess Blue had the game of his life against Louisiana-Monroe on Saturday when he made two great touchdown catches.

Blue nearly matched his season total in yards at the start of the fourth quarter with 109 receiving yards and his first two touchdowns of the season as Kentucky had little trouble moving the ball against the Warhawks.
There are still plenty of SEC teams yet to play today, but this one is the leader in the clubhouse for the best catch in the SEC for the week as Blue made a spectacular catch in the end zone for the touchdown.
